#  The following drive type mapping scheme is employed:
#     For TLD libraries and Standalone drives:
#	- Any DLT7000 drive is set to 9  (DLT)
#	- Any DLT4000 drive is set to 11 (DLT2)
#	- Any DLT8000 drive is set to 11 (DLT2)
#	- Any DLT2000 drive is set to 17 (DLT3)
#	- Any SDLT220 drive is set to 17 (DLT3)
#       - Any SDLT320 drive is set to 11 (DLT2)
#	- Any IBM3590 drive is set to 3  (hcart)
#	- Any Fujitsu drive is set to 3  (hcart)
#       - Any STK4490 drive is set to 16 (hcart3)
#       - Any STK4890 drive is set to 3  (hcart)	
#       - Any STK9490 drive is set to 3  (hcart)	
#       - Any STK9840 drive is set to 3  (hcart) 
#       - Any STKT9940A drive is set to 10 (hcart2) 
#       - Any Redwood drive is set to 10 (hcart2)
#     For TSD libraries, all drives will be set to DLT
#     For TSH libraries, all drives will be set to hcart
#     For TL8 and TS8 libraries all drives will be set to 8mm
#     For Tl4 libraries, all drives will be set to 4mm
